Data Modeling Course Overview

Mindmajix Data Modeling training will help you learn how to create data models through a hands-on approach. The course will walk you through the fundamentals of data modeling and provides knowledge on how to create a UML data model, add attributes, classes, and simplify the model. You’ll also learn about data modeling patterns, database reverse engineering, and more through real-time projects and use cases. Enroll now and get certified.

Why Should you learn Data Modeling ?

Key Features

Modes of Training

Self-Paced Learning
  • Learn at your convenient time and pace
  • Gain on-the-job kind of learning experience through high quality Data Modeling videos built by industry experts.
  • Learn end to end course content that is similar to instructor led virtual/classroom training.
  • Explore trial videos before signing up.
Get Free Trial
Live Online Training
  • Live demonstration of of features and practicals.
  • Get LMS access of each Data Modeling Online training session that you attend through GotoMeeting.
  • Gain guidance on certification.
  • Attend a Demo before signing up.

Next Demo Sessions

25th Jan, 2020 (Weekend)
30th Jan, 2020 (Weekday)
Get Pricing
Corporate Training
For Business
  • Self-Paced/Live Online/Classroom modes of training available.
  • Engage in Data Modeling Classroom Training lecture by an industry expert at your facility.
  • Learn as per full day schedule with discussions,exercises and practical use cases.
  • Design your own course content based on your project requirements.
  • Gain complete guidance on certification.
Contact Us

Data Modeling Course Content

In this module, we will discuss about the basic concepts of a Data Warehouse and why it is needed. Difference between an operational system and an analytical system, Data marts and approaches to build a data warehouse.

  • An introduction to Data Warehousing
  • Purpose of Data Warehouse
  • Data Warehouse Architecture
  • Operational Data Store
  • OLTP Vs Warehouse Applications
  • Data Marts
  • Data marts Vs Data Warehouses
  • Data Warehouse Life cycle

Data modeling is the analysis of data objects that are used in a business or other context and the identification of the relationships among these data objects. It is a first step in doing object-oriented programming. In this module, you will also learn different phases in Data Modeling.

  • Introduction of Data Modeling
  • Different Phases of Data Modelling

Learn Data Modelling, what a dimension and a fact is, the different types of dimensions and facts. Reporting concept of Hierarchy

  • What Is a Dimension in Data Modeling
  • What are Facts?
  • Multi Dimensional Model
  • Hierarchies, Data Modeling – OLAP
  • Data Modeling – MOLAP
  • Data Modeling – ROLAP
  • Data Modeling – HOLAP
  • Cubes and its Functions
  • Star Schema
  • Fact Table
  • Dimensional Tables
  • Snow flake Schema
  • Fact less Fact Table
  • Confirmed Dimensions

This module gives you an brief description about the different types of Engineering and Concept of Alter database.

  • Introduction to Erwin
  • Forward Engineering
  • Reverse Engineering
  • Update Model
  • Alter database
  • Complete compare

Mindmajix offers advanced Data Modeling interview questions and answers along with Data Modeling resume samples. Take a free sample practice test before appearing in the certification to improve your chances of scoring high.


  • To put your knowledge on Data Modeling Training into action, you will be required to work on two industry-based projects that discuss significant real-time use cases. You will gain hands-on expertise in Data Modeling Training concepts with this practical experience.
  • These projects are completely in-line with the modules mentioned in the curriculum and help you to clear the Data Modeling Training certification exam.

Our Course in Comparison


  • Demos at Convenient Time?
  • 1-1 Training
  • Batch Start Dates
  • Customize Course Content
  • EMI Option
  • Group Discounts


  • At your Convenience


  • Fixed

Data Modeling Online Training Objectives

By the end of this course, you’ll master the following areas:

  • Data Modeling Concepts and their Applications
  • Differentiate between logical data modeling and physical database design
  • Applying a repeatable four-step process to perform logical data modeling
  • Data model concepts including entities, attributes, and relationships
  • Handling complex relationships including Many-to-many, Recursive/”Bill of Materials”, and Subtypes and supertypes 
  • Documenting the data model with an Entity/Relationship diagram and validating it
  • Data Modeling has been adopted by well-known organizations thereby creating huge employment opportunities worldwide.
  • According to MarketsandMarket, the Enterprise Data Management market is expected to reach $105 billion by the end of next year. 
  • The average salary of a Data Modeling developer is $110,000 per annum–

The below job roles will get benefited from this training:

  • Database Modelers
  • Analytics Managers
  • Database Administrators
  • Data Scientists and Analysts
  • ETL and BI Developers
  • Aspirants looking for a career in Data Modeling

There are no certain prerequisites to learn Data Modeling as the course is being designed in such a way that even beginners can learn from scratch.

Upon completion of this course, the aspirants will be able to gain knowledge on:

  • Data Modeling Concepts and BI life cycle
  • ERwin database and the concepts of RDBMS
  • Working with snowflake and star schema
  • Working with SQL data, SQL parsing, and SQL modeler
  • Data modeling using ERwin design layer architecture

Data Modeling Certification

Our Data Modeling course covers all the topics that are required to clear Data Modeling certification. Trainer will share Data Modeling certification guide, Data Modeling certification sample questions, Data Modeling certification practice questions.

Trusted By Companies Worldwide & 3,50,850+ Learners

Data Modeling Certification Training Course - FAQ's

Yes, you get two kinds of discounts. They are group discount and referral discount. Group discount is offered when you join as a group, and referral discount is offered when you are referred from someone who has already enrolled in our training.

Yes, we will discuss with our instructor and will schedule according to the time convenient to you.

The trainer will give Server Access to the course seekers, and we make sure you acquire practical hands-on training by providing you with every utility that is needed for your understanding of the course.

The trainer is a certified consultant and has significant amount of experience in working with the technology.

We will take care of providing you with all that is required to get placed in a reputed MNC and also forward your resume to the companies we tie-up with. Starting from providing the in-depth course material to explanation of the real-time scenarios and preparing your resumes, we will make you gain expertise so that you can get a job.

We assist you completely in acquiring certification. We ensure you will get certified easily after our training.

Yes, we accept payments in two installments.

If you are enrolled in classes and/or have paid fees, but want to cancel the registration for certain reason, it can be attained within first 2 sessions of the training. Please make a note that refunds will be processed within 30 days of prior request.

Our trainer explains every topic along with real-time scenarios. In the last one or two sessions, the trainer will explain one end-to-end project to showcase the real time working environment.

User Reviews on popular courses

Naba Kumar Sarker

I appreciate the level of details put into the data modeling course material. The methodology and advice provided throughout the course content will add great value to my work.


With My Personal Experience, I Can Vouch That, Mindmajix Is An Excellent Coaching Institute For Data Modeling. Before Joining, You Can Attend The Demo Classes, The Faculty Is Very Dedicated, The Course Structure Is Satisfying. Thanks Mindmajix.

Rohhit Pinjarkar

Mindmajix Data Modeling Training covered each topic with interesting lectures. The presentation of materials was good, making it easy to understand even for the beginners.

Roland Ferrao

It was a wonderful learning experience. Trainer's knowledge is impressive, and great teaching capability. The Data Modelling course content is great. The session was interactive which was very good. I have gained in-depth knowledge on all the concepts of Data Modeling, Thanks for everything Mindmajix.

Srinivas Mangilpally

It is step by step approach to help each problem related to Data Modeling online training. I'm quite impressed by Mindmajix. Thanks to the trainer who made the tutorials so simple. Good job.

Tulasi Pemmasani

I would like to recommend Mindmajix to anyone who wants to be a master in any IT technology.i have taken Data Modelling Certification training. Explanations are clean, clear, easy to understand and every question receives the right answer during the training. Thanks to Mindmajix for all the help and support.

Asif Hasan

I took .NET training from Mindmajix. I must say the course content was highly qualitative and the trainer covered all concepts. Overall it was a good experience with Mindmajix.

Find Data Modeling Training in Other Locations

To meet the learning needs of people spread across various geographical locations, we are offering our high-quality training services at the location of your choice to ensure you obtain maximum impact for your training investment. Choose your city below.

Data Modeling Training in Hyderabad

Hyderabad is the capital city of Telangana state and is well known for the major technology township, HITECH city, as well as India’s largest start-up ecosystem, T-Hub. It attracted more than 1500 IT firms including Apple, Microsoft, Amazon, Google, Salesforce, and many more. Therefore, the future scope of IT industry sounds great in Hyderabad with enormous opportunities for software professionals. Mindmajix Data Modeling Training in Hyderabad is designed to uplift your career in this domain.

Our Hyderabad Correspondence / Mailing address

Ecohouse Building, Nagarjuna Hills, Panjagutta Hyderabad Telangana 500082 India

View on Maps

Data Modeling Training in Bangalore

Bangalore is the IT capital of India and is regarded as one of the top 10 fastest growing cities in the world with an average economic growth rate of 8.5%. The city has attracted a large number of IT firms, startup investments, research and development organizations, and many more. Data Modeling Training is an ever-changing field which has numerous job opportunities and excellent career scope. Our Data Modeling Training in Bangalore is designed to enhance your skillset and successfully clear the Data Modeling Training certification exam.

Our Bangalore Correspondence / Mailing address

91Springboard, 512/10, Service Lane, Outer Ring Road, Mahadevapura, Next to More Megastore, Bangalore - 560048 Karnataka

View on Maps

+ more cities